"I allow myself to cry about it, but then I always say to myself, 'What did I learn from this and what is the whisper from the universe? And what am I meant to do next?' I really view this as messages that are meant to take me to the next level." - Angela Jia Kim Angela Jia Kim is a former concert pianist and founder of Savor Beauty + Spa, a Manhattan-based skincare and spa brand inspired by Korean beauty rituals. She's also the author of Radical Radiance: 12 Weeks of Self-Love Rituals to Manifest Abundance, Beauty, and Joy and the creator of the Savor Beauty Planner, a self-care guide that helps women manifest beauty, brilliance, and balance.
